“Preliminary Discourse on the Study of Natural Philosophy” by John F. W. Herschel is a seminal work that serves as both an introduction and a manifesto for the study of the natural sciences in the 19th century. Herschel, a prominent scientist and philosopher, articulates the methodologies and principles that underpin scientific inquiry, emphasizing the importance of observation, experimentation, and reasoning in the pursuit of knowledge. Through articulate prose and thoughtful analysis, Herschel encourages a systematic approach to the examination of the natural world, advocating for the integration of mathematical precision with empirical observation. His insights on the nature of scientific progress underscore the dynamic interplay between theory and practice, foreshadowing modern scientific methods. This discourse not only reflects Herschel’s deep understanding of natural philosophy but also serves as an intellectual touchstone for future generations of scientists. It remains a vital read for anyone interested in the foundations of scientific thought and inquiry.
